When planning your writing project, consider the following two key factors:
What is the Purpose of Your Writing Project?
- Are you summarizing information, informing stakeholders, offering solutions to a problem or pursuing another objective?
- Knowing the answer to this question will guide your choice of words, tone, and the project's length.
- For instance, decide if a formal tone is necessary, or if a less formal approach will suffice, provided it remains professional and, where necessary, authoritative.
Focus on the Audience
- Identify your readers and their characteristics. Are they likely to be individuals/families, small business owners, pedestrians, environmentalists? Consider their age range and technological proficiency.
- Think about what your audience needs to know rather than what you wish to convey.
- If you are addressing multiple audiences, strategize how to adapt your message to meet everyone's information needs. We are happy to work with you on tailoring your message to a diverse audience.
